Please charge before first use. Normally, press and hold the Powe r key will power the tablet on and the Home Screen will show
up, but a battery icon will show instead of the Home Screen when the tablet is lack of power, that indicates you should charge
before use. Use only charger recommended by TCT Mobile Limited and its affiliates.
This device cannot be charged through usb computer connection. Please plug in your charger before first usage.

Press and hold the Powe r key until the tablet powers on. It will take some seconds before the screen lights up.
1.4.2 Power off your device
• Press a nd hold th e Power key abo ut 3 seco nds unti l the opt ions ap pear, selec t "Powe r off " to power of f your dev ice.
• Press and hold the Powe r key about 10 seconds to shut down your device.
1.4.3 Stand-by mode
Press Powe r key once to shut down the screen and the product enters stand-by mode.
Note: Without operation, the product will enter stand-by mode automatically. Press Powe r key once to wake it up.
1.4.4 Restart
• Press and hold the Power key about 3 seconds until the options appear, select "Restart " to restart your device.
• When your device is out of function, press and hold the Powe r key about 10 seconds to shut down your device. Then press the Powe r
key to restart.

• TRAFFIC SAFETY
Given that studies show that using a device while driving a vehicle constitutes a real risk, even when the hands-free kit is used (car kit,
headset...), drivers are requested to refrain from using their device when the vehicle is not parked.
When driving, do not use your device or headphone to listen to music or to the radio. Using a headphone can be dangerous and forbidden
in some areas. When switched on, your device emits electromagnetic waves that can interfere with the vehicle’s electronic systems such as
ABS anti-lock brakes or airbags. To ensure that there is no problem:
- do not place your device on top of the dashboard or within an airbag deployment area,
- check with your car dealer or the car manufacturer to make sure that the dashboard is adequately shielded from device RF energy.
• CONDITIONS OF USE
You are advised to switch off the device from time to time to optimize its performance.
Switch the device off before boarding an aircraft.
Switch the device off when you are in healthcare facilities, except in designated areas. As with many other types of equipment now in regular
use, these devices can interfere with other electrical or electronic devices, or equipment using radio frequencies.
Switch the device off when you are near gas or flammable liquids. Strictly obey all signs and instructions posted in a fuel depot, petrol station,
or chemical plant, or in any potentially explosive atmosphere.
When the device is switched on, it should be kept at least 15 cm from any medical device such as a pacemaker, a hearing aid or insulin pump,
etc. In particular when using the device, you should hold it against the ear on the opposite side to the device, if any.

Some people may suffer epileptic seizures or blackouts when exposed to flashing lights, or when playing video games. These seizures or
blackouts may occur even if a person never had a previous seizure or blackout. If you have experienced seizures or blackouts, or if you
have a family history of such occurrences, please consult your doctor before playing video games on your device or enabling a flashing-lights
feature on your device.
Parents should monitor their children’s use of video games or other features that incorporate flashing lights on the device. All persons
should discontinue use and consult a doctor if any of the following symptoms occur: convulsion, eye or muscle twitching, loss of awareness,
involuntary movements, or disorientation. To limit the likelihood of such symptoms, please take the following safety precautions:
- Do not play or use a flashing-lights feature if you are tired or need sleep.
- Take a minimum of a 15-minute break hourly.
- Play in a room in which all lights are on.
- Play at the farthest distance possible from the screen.
- If your hands, wrists, or arms become tired or sore while playing, stop and rest for several hours before playing again.
- If you continue to have sore hands, wrists, or arms during or after playing, stop the game and see a doctor.
When you play games on your device, you may experience occasional discomfort in your hands, arms, shoulders, neck, or other parts
of your body. Follow the instructions to avoid problems such as tendinitis, carpal tunnel syndrome, or other musculoskeletal disorders.

Your device is warranted against any defect or malfunctioning which may occur in conditions of normal use during the warranty period of
twelve (12) months (1) from the date of purchase as shown on your original invoice.
Batteries (2) and accessories sold with your device are also warranted against any defect which may occur during the first six (6) months
(1) from the date of purchase as shown on your original invoice.
In case of any defect of your device which prevents you from normal use thereof, you must immediately inform your vendor and present
your device with your proof of purchase.
(1) The warranty period may vary depending on your country.
(2) The life of a rechargeable mobile device battery in terms of conversation time standby time, and total service life, will depend on the
conditions of use and network configuration. Batteries being considered expendable supplies, the specifications state that you should
obtain optimal performance for your device during the first six months after purchase and for approximately 200 more recharges.
If the defect is confirmed, your device or part thereof will be either replaced or repaired, as appropriate. Repaired device and accessories
are entitled to a one (1) month warranty for the same defect. Repair or replacement may be carried out using reconditioned components
offering equivalent functionality.
This warranty covers the cost of parts and labor but excludes any other costs.
